Community Forums
Connect with us on LinkedIn
Community Notice
+ Reply to Thread
Results 1 to 10 of 10
  1. #1
    Member PPNSteve's Avatar
    Join Date
    Mar 2003
    Location
    Somewhere in Ilex Forest
    Posts
    288

    Exclamation checkperlmodules] The perl module Archive::Zip could not be installed

    This module is required by cPanel, and the system may not function correctly until it is installed, and functional. Below is the results of the auto-install attempt:

    Test Run
    ==============
    Bareword "Cwd::getcwd" not allowed while "strict subs" in use at /usr/lib/perl5/site_perl/5.8.8/Archive/Zip.pm line 552.
    Compilation failed in require at - line 1.
    BEGIN failed--compilation aborted at - line 1.


    Installer Run
    ==============
    Testing connection speed...(using fast method)...Done
    Ping:0.394 Testing connection speed to 209.85.80.214 using pureperl...(311100.00 bytes/s)...Done
    Ping:5.894 Testing connection speed to 72.233.42.250 using pureperl...(311000.00 bytes/s)...Done
    Ping:1.129 Testing connection speed to 208.74.121.39 using pureperl...(311000.00 bytes/s)...Done
    Three usable mirrors located
    Three usable mirrors located
    Mirror Check passed for 209.85.80.214 (/index.html)
    Unknown config variable 'less'
    commit: wrote '/usr/lib/perl5/5.8.8/CPAN/Config.pm'
    CPAN: Storable loaded ok (v2.20)
    Going to read /home/.cpan/Metadata
    Database was generated on Tue, 30 Jun 2009 09:27:00 GMT
    Running install for module 'Archive::Zip'
    Running make for A/AD/ADAMK/Archive-Zip-1.29.tar.gz
    CPAN: Digest::SHA loaded ok (v5.47)
    CPAN: Compress::Zlib loaded ok (v2.019)
    Checksum for /home/.cpan/sources/authors/id/A/AD/ADAMK/Archive-Zip-1.29.tar.gz ok

    ...cut...

    ADAMK/Archive-Zip-1.29.tar.gz
    /usr/bin/make -- OK
    Running make install
    Appending installation info to /usr/lib/perl5/5.8.8/i686-linux/perllocal.pod
    ADAMK/Archive-Zip-1.29.tar.gz
    /usr/bin/make install UNINST=1 -- OK
    cPCPAN: Module (File::Spec) holdback (3.30 held back to 3.25)
    Running get for module 'File::Spec'
    CPAN: LWP::UserAgent loaded ok (v5.823)
    CPAN: Time::HiRes loaded ok (v1.9719)
    Fetching with LWP:
    http://209.85.80.214/pub/CPAN/author...ls-3.25.tar.gz
    LWP failed with code[404] message[Not Found]

    Trying with "/usr/bin/wget -O /home/.cpan/sources/authors/id/S/SM/SMUELLER/PathTools-3.25.tar.tmp19898" to get
    http://209.85.80.214/pub/CPAN/author...ls-3.25.tar.gz

    --06:47:28-- http://209.85.80.214/pub/CPAN/author...ls-3.25.tar.gz
    => `/home/.cpan/sources/authors/id/S/SM/SMUELLER/PathTools-3.25.tar.tmp19898'
    Connecting to 209.85.80.214:80... connected.
    HTTP request sent, awaiting response... 404 Not Found
    06:47:28 ERROR 404: Not Found.


    System call "/usr/bin/wget -O /home/.cpan/sources/authors/id/S/SM/SMUELLER/PathTools-3.25.tar.tmp19898 "http://209.85.80.214/pub/CPAN/authors/id/S/SM/SMUELLER/PathTools-3.25.tar.gz" "
    returned status 1 (wstat 256)
    Warning: expected file [/home/.cpan/sources/authors/id/S/SM/SMUELLER/PathTools-3.25.tar.gz.tmp19898] doesn't exist
    Fetching with LWP:
    http://72.233.42.250/pub/CPAN/author...ls-3.25.tar.gz

    LWP failed with code[404] message[Not Found]

    Trying with "/usr/bin/wget -O /home/.cpan/sources/authors/id/S/SM/SMUELLER/PathTools-3.25.tar.tmp19898" to get
    http://72.233.42.250/pub/CPAN/author...ls-3.25.tar.gz

    --06:47:28-- http://72.233.42.250/pub/CPAN/author...ls-3.25.tar.gz
    => `/home/.cpan/sources/authors/id/S/SM/SMUELLER/PathTools-3.25.tar.tmp19898'
    Connecting to 72.233.42.250:80... connected.
    HTTP request sent, awaiting response... 404 Not Found
    06:47:28 ERROR 404: Not Found.
    ...cut...
    many more 404's and so on
    ...
    Could not fetch authors/id/S/SM/SMUELLER/PathTools-3.25.tar.gz
    Giving up on '/home/.cpan/sources/authors/id/S/SM/SMUELLER/PathTools-3.25.tar.gz'
    Note: Current database in memory was generated on Tue, 30 Jun 2009 09:27:00 GMT

    Running get for module 'File::Spec'
    Checksum for /home/.cpan/sources/authors/id/cPCPAN/PathTools-3.25.tar.gz ok
    PathTools-3.25/
    PathTools-3.25/Build.PL
    PathTools-3.25/Changes
    PathTools-3.25/Cwd.pm
    PathTools-3.25/Cwd.xs
    PathTools-3.25/INSTALL
    PathTools-3.25/lib/
    PathTools-3.25/lib/File/
    PathTools-3.25/lib/File/Spec/
    PathTools-3.25/lib/File/Spec/Cygwin.pm
    PathTools-3.25/lib/File/Spec/Epoc.pm
    PathTools-3.25/lib/File/Spec/Functions.pm
    PathTools-3.25/lib/File/Spec/Mac.pm
    PathTools-3.25/lib/File/Spec/OS2.pm
    PathTools-3.25/lib/File/Spec/Unix.pm
    PathTools-3.25/lib/File/Spec/VMS.pm
    PathTools-3.25/lib/File/Spec/Win32.pm
    PathTools-3.25/lib/File/Spec.pm
    PathTools-3.25/Makefile.PL
    PathTools-3.25/MANIFEST
    PathTools-3.25/META.yml
    PathTools-3.25/ppport.h
    PathTools-3.25/SIGNATURE
    PathTools-3.25/t/
    PathTools-3.25/t/crossplatform.t
    PathTools-3.25/t/cwd.t
    PathTools-3.25/t/Functions.t
    PathTools-3.25/t/lib/
    PathTools-3.25/t/lib/Test/
    PathTools-3.25/t/lib/Test/Builder.pm
    PathTools-3.25/t/lib/Test/More.pm
    PathTools-3.25/t/lib/Test/Simple.pm
    PathTools-3.25/t/lib/Test/Tutorial.pod
    PathTools-3.25/t/rel2abs2rel.t
    PathTools-3.25/t/Spec.t
    PathTools-3.25/t/taint.t
    PathTools-3.25/t/tmpdir.t
    PathTools-3.25/t/win32.t
    CPAN: Module::Build loaded ok (v0.33)
    cPCPAN: Module (Compress::Raw::Zlib) holdback (2.020 held back to 2.019)
    perlmod--Install done
    ...end...

    so,
    new update on current tonight.. anyone else seeing this error? Have a solution, if one is needed?
    Steve H.
    --------------
    1-GB.NET
    Domain Names

  2. #2
    Member
    Join Date
    Oct 2006
    Location
    Cheshire, UK
    Posts
    196

    Default

    According to Index of /pub/CPAN/authors/id/S/SM/SMUELLER/, this is an old PathTools release cPanel is trying to upgrade to. Version 3.30 was released in May this year, so I'm not sure why cPanel is using an older version of the software currently??

    Anyone know how to cure this?

  3. #3
    Member
    Join Date
    Oct 2006
    Location
    Cheshire, UK
    Posts
    196

    Default

    I logged this issue via cPanel Support and they reckon this is perfectly normal and that cPanel has functioned as it's meant to when modules are due for upgrade.

    Thing is this isn't normal - I've receiving error emails with this exact output from all my servers every time they check for Perl module updates now.

  4. #4
    Member
    Join Date
    Oct 2005
    Posts
    121

    Default

    I got messages from my servers as well this morning.

    Test Run
    ==============
    Bareword "Cwd::getcwd" not allowed while "strict subs" in use at /usr/lib/perl5/site_perl/5.8.8/Archive/Zip.pm line 552.
    Compilation failed in require at - line 1.
    BEGIN failed--compilation aborted at - line 1.

  5. #5
    Registered User
    Join Date
    Jul 2009
    Posts
    1

    Default Also getting message

    Any advice on installing the module manually? The 1.28 version is also sitting in the /home/.cpan/sources/authors/id/A/AD/ADAMK/ directory.

  6. #6
    Member
    Join Date
    Jul 2005
    Posts
    54

    Default

    Quote Originally Posted by billread View Post
    Any advice on installing the module manually? The 1.28 version is also sitting in the /home/.cpan/sources/authors/id/A/AD/ADAMK/ directory.
    it killed my mailscanner...

    Code:
    root@chicago1 [/var/log]# service MailScanner start
    Starting MailScanner daemons:
             MailScanner:       Bareword "Cwd::getcwd" not allowed while "strict subs" in use at /usr/lib/perl5/site_perl/5.8.8/Archive/Zip.pm line 552.
    Compilation failed in require at /usr/mailscanner/lib/MailScanner/Message.pm line 48.
    BEGIN failed--compilation aborted at /usr/mailscanner/lib/MailScanner/Message.pm line 48.
    Compilation failed in require at /usr/mailscanner/bin/MailScanner line 107.
    BEGIN failed--compilation aborted at /usr/mailscanner/bin/MailScanner line 107.

  7. #7
    Member
    Join Date
    Jul 2005
    Posts
    54

    Default

    This worked...

    ConfigServer Blog

    Thanks Chirpy!

  8. #8
    Member
    Join Date
    Oct 2005
    Posts
    121

    Default

    I was just going to update the thread about the mailscanner issue. I had to use the manual fix on both my servers. The /scripts... one didn't automatically fix it.

  9. #9
    Member
    Join Date
    Jul 2005
    Posts
    54

    Default

    Same here

    Code:
    wget http://search.cpan.org/CPAN/authors/id/A/AD/ADAMK/Archive-Zip-1.30.tar.gz
    tar -xzf Archive-Zip-1.30.tar.gz
    cd Archive-Zip-1.30
    perl Makefile.PL
    make
    make install

  10. #10
    Member orty's Avatar
    Join Date
    Jun 2004
    Location
    Bend, Oregon
    Posts
    92

    Default

    Quote Originally Posted by Serra View Post
    I was just going to update the thread about the mailscanner issue. I had to use the manual fix on both my servers. The /scripts... one didn't automatically fix it.
    Same here. The cpan mirrors my servers were hooking up to didn't have the new version yet.
    Jake Ortman: Jake-of-all-Trades Geek/Blogger

Similar Threads & Tags
Similar threads

  1. Replies: 0
    Last Post: 08-23-2011, 08:55 AM
  2. [checkperlmodules] The perl module Crypt::SSLeay could not be installed.
    By crazyaboutlinux in forum Database Discussions
    Replies: 1
    Last Post: 04-24-2009, 12:26 PM
  3. Replies: 0
    Last Post: 06-10-2008, 05:14 AM
  4. [checkperlmodules] The perl module XXXXX could not be installed.
    By Jonno in forum cPanel and WHM Discussions
    Replies: 24
    Last Post: 08-31-2007, 08:39 PM
  5. Replies: 5
    Last Post: 05-21-2007, 02:52 PM
Linkedin       Facebook       Twitter       RSS       Flickr       YouTube